Title: The Innovative Contributions of Ehrenfried Bitrolf
Introduction
Ehrenfried Bitrolf, a notable inventor based in Bretten-Ruit, Germany, has made significant contributions to the field of medical technology. With an impressive portfolio of six patents, Bitrolf's inventions have focused on enhancing the functionality and efficiency of medical apparatus systems, particularly in endoscopy.
Latest Patents
Bitrolf's latest innovations include groundbreaking patents that advance automatic identification methods and electro-surgical instruments. One notable invention is a method and device for the automatic identification of components within medical apparatus systems. This invention describes a system where a separate unit, which includes a write-read head, can identify components such as those found in video endoscope systems. Each component is equipped with a writable and readable data carrier that stores essential data signals. This touch-free data transmission system utilizes inductive energy to facilitate easy communication between the unit and components.
Additionally, his patent for an electro-surgical instrument showcases his engineering acumen. This device features a probe stem with a distal electrode capable of both coagulation and resection accompanied by coagulation. The innovative design includes a part-spherical portion and an angled annular portion to optimize surgical procedures.
Career Highlights
Bitrolf's career is marked by his role at Richard Wolf GmbH, a leading manufacturer of medical instruments. His work has significantly impacted the company's offerings in medical technology, improving patient outcomes and operational efficiency in surgical environments.
